The story of Joseph Cramer began in 1884 in Rockville, Indiana. In 1910, Joseph Cramer resided in Adams, Parke, Indiana, USA. In 1917, Joseph Cramer resided in Parke County, Indiana, USA. Joseph Cramer married Eva Charlotte Kirkpatrick, and had children including Ida Frances Cramer, Paul Kramer, Rose Josephine Cramer, Winifred Mary Cramer. Joseph Cramer passed away in 1954 in Rockville, Parke County, Indiana, United States of America.
